VPort 251 User’s Manual Introduction
RS-232/RS-422/RS-485 COM port
The VPort 251 has 1 COM port for PTZ control. This COM port is an RS-232/RS-422/485 serial
port with 5 pin terminal block connector. The pin assignments are as follows:

To enable PTZ control, users should configure the PTZ control protocol in the web console.
NOTE
The PTZ control protocol is not standardized. To use a particular PTZ control protocol, the video
encoder must support the driver for that protocol. Currently, the VPort 251 supports PTZ control
protocol drivers for:
1. Pelco D
2. Pelco P
3. Dynacolor DynaDome
In addition, there is an item named “Transparent PTZ Control” in the camera driver list, which is
to transmit the PTZ control signal via TCP/IP network to the VPort D251 video decoder or PC
(additional Real COM driver required), and the PTZ control panel or keyboard can directly
control the PTZ camera or device. In this way, there is no need for PTZ camera driver and better
than that, you don’t have the protocol limitation for using PTZ camera with VPort encoders.
In addition, to use a protocol that is not on the list, you will need to contact the manufacturer of
the camera to get the PTZ control commands, and then use the VPort 251’s custom camera
function to program the PTZ control.
NOTE
The VPort 251 comes with a PTZ driver upload function for implementing new PTZ drivers.
Please contact a Moxa sales representative if you need assistance from Moxa’s R&D department
to create a new PTZ driver.
12/24 VDC and 24 VAC power input and loop-through power output
VPort 251 is powerd by 12/24VDC or 24VAC power adaptor with power jack connector. In
addition, a loop-through power output in 2-pin termina block connector type is aslo provided for
poweing the external device, such as camera. Since the power input and output is loop-throughed,
the 2-pin power output can also be used as an alternative power input connector.
NOTE
The supported power input specifications for the VPort 251 series are 12-32 VDC for a 12/24
VDC power input, or 18-30 VAC for a 24 VAC power input.
